What is Ad Fraud? (It’s Expensive) 💸

Defining Fraud: Ad fraud and Bots come in many forms, each designed to siphon budgets without delivering results.

Common types include click fraud in PPC campaigns, where bots (or competitors) generate fake clicks to exhaust budgets, and impression fraud in display advertising, using tactics like ad stacking and pixel stuffing to inflate metrics without delivering value. 😬

Common Types of Ad Fraud

Click Fraud: 🤖 Bots or competitors generate fake clicks to exhaust budgets.
Impression Fraud in Ads : 📊 Techniques like ad stacking and pixel stuffing inflate metrics without delivering value.
Video ad fraud involves fake video views and ad injection techniques that trick advertisers into believing their ads have been genuinely seen.

Programmatic advertising is most vulnerable, with fraudsters using domain spoofing to impersonate premium websites and auction manipulation to inflate ad prices.

To make matters worse, the sophistication of these tactics continues to evolve, making the fight against fraud an ongoing challenge.

How AI Combats Ad Fraud 🥷🏼

Put simply: AI offers a powerful addition to traditional fraud detection methods. It leverages machine learning algorithms to process vast amounts of data (faster) and identify fraudulent activities in real-time.

Faster Detection = More Money Saved.

Here’s How AI Does It:

Real-Time Analysis
  • Instantaneous transaction verification
  • Live traffic pattern monitoring
  • Dynamic risk scoring
  • Immediate threat response
Pattern Recognition
  • User behavior fingerprinting
  • Device fingerprinting
  • Traffic source analysis
  • Click pattern analysis
  • Time-based activity analysis
Anomaly Detection
  • Statistical outlier identification
  • Behavioral deviation tracking
  • Suspicious pattern flagging
  • Velocity checking
  • Geographic anomaly detection

The big issue: advertiser Mindset 🧠

The main challenge I see is that advertisers commonly don’t believe they actually have this issue.

I encourage you to have a scroll through > 10 case fraud studies:

  1. The Weasel Fraud (2023) – A sophisticated scheme where Wease.IM conducted unauthorized secondary auctions within display ad units, manipulating the advertising ecosystem.
  2. VASTFLUX Operation (2023) – A massive mobile ad fraud scheme that affected over 11 million devices, injecting malicious JavaScript code into legitimate ads.
  3. Hydra Scheme (2020) – A sophisticated fraud operation that used fake apps and bot networks to generate artificial traffic and steal $130 Million in advertising budgets.
  4. Rapid Fire CTV (2021) – A large-scale click fraud operation $20 Million a month that targets server-side ad insertion (SSAI) as a means to “spoof” CTV inventory across a large number of apps, IP addresses and devices.
  5. Methbot/3ve Aftermath (2015-2022) – One of the largest ad fraud operations, which generated fake traffic through data center servers and bot networks.
  6. PARETO Operation (2021) – A sophisticated CTV fraud scheme that affected over 1 million mobile devices, generating fake ad impressions on streaming platforms.
  7. TERRACOTTA (2020) – A massive mobile ad fraud operation that infected Android devices with malware to generate 2 Billon fake ad clicks.
  8. The 404Bot Scheme (2020) – A sophisticated fraud operation that exploited webpage errors to generate fake traffic and steal advertising revenue.
  9. DrainerBot (2019-Now) – A major mobile ad fraud operation that drained users’ data and battery life while generating fake ad impressions.
  10. Video Optimization Fraud (2023) – Part of the estimated $84 billion lost to ad fraud in 2023, involving fake video views and manipulated metrics

Tools we use to stop the Bot 🔨

Depending on your budget, media channels, and level of risk, here is my list on some tools to start with to combat the ad fraud issue

  • Cloudflare – Goes from Free to Enterprise. If I only had one tool to battle bots I’d start here.

Low Budget, Basic Risk Mitigation

  • Ads.txt: Prevents unauthorized selling of progammatic inventory.
  • Google Analytics: Look for Zero time on site and other bot signals (Same IP, City, Device)
  • Google Ads Verification Reports: Utilize built-in platform tools to identify suspicious activity.

Medium Budget, Multi-Channel Fraud Protection

  • ClickCease: For $80 a month protects against click fraud across PPC platforms like Google Ads and Meta Ads.
  • AppsFlyer Protect360: Helps protect mobile ad campaigns from fraud.
  • Integral Ad Science (IAS): Offers insights into invalid traffic (IVT) for display, video, and programmatic ads.

High Budget, Advanced Multi-Channel Solutions

  • Human (formerly White Ops): Offers sophisticated bot detection across devices and environments.
  • Forensiq by Impact: Provides cross-channel fraud detection, including app install fraud, bot detection, and impression fraud.
  • Pixalate: A comprehensive tool offering fraud prevention and detection across OTT, mobile, and programmatic ads.
  • Fraudlogix: Specializes in preventing real-time, cross-channel ad fraud, including display and mobile.
